Generation from PVGIS v5.2 (European Commission JRC, SARAH3), retrieved August 2026 for a representative point in Kent (51.2489, 0.6745), assuming 1 kWp, 14% system loss, 35 degree pitch, due south. Import valued at 26.32p/kWh (Ofgem price cap average, Oct to Dec 2026); off-peak charging at 8p/kWh where used (a supplier's published EV off-peak rate, checked Aug 2026); export at the scenario you pick, from the dated tariff table. Prices are installed pricing, August 2026, standard installations; 530W LONGi panels at £1,000 per kWp. Estimates for illustration, not a quote: your free design call prices your actual roof.

Local detail

Local detail for Kent

Kent County Council's own 2021 Census bulletin shows houses and bungalows dominating at 80.4% of households, with semi-detached the largest single category at 31.4%, close to the England and Wales figure, detached homes at 25.4% and terraces at 23.5%, both above the regional average. Purpose-built flats make up 14.0%, and the county's dwelling stock grew by 59,841 homes, or 9.4%, between the 2011 and 2021 censuses, so a fair share of Kent's roofs are on relatively new-build homes rather than older stock.

Kent sits in UK Power Networks territory, on its South Eastern Power Networks licence; the 45 working day industry standard applies to a standard low voltage generation quotation, with most single home systems using the quicker 28-day G98 route instead. Kent's twelve district and borough councils decide most planning applications, including household solar, while Kent County Council leads on strategic, minerals and waste planning; Kent Downs National Landscape, the renamed AONB, treats rooftop solar on existing buildings as generally compatible, unlike ground-mounted solar farms, which it usually resists.

Cleve Hill Solar Park, near Graveney between Faversham and Whitstable, is a 373MW solar farm with more than 550,000 panels plus battery storage, fully operational since summer 2025 and generating enough for more than 102,000 homes. UK Power Networks has also installed what it calls the UK's first smart electricity substation in Maidstone, using AI to free up to 50% more network capacity for new connections, solar included, across the South East.

Network operator (DNO): UK Power Networks · G99 application

Planning authority: Kent has a two-tier structure. Kent County Council is the Minerals and Waste Planning Authority for the county, leading on strategic, minerals and waste planning. The twelve district and borough councils (Maidstone, Tunbridge Wells, Canterbury, Dartford, Ashford, Dover, Sevenoaks, Swale, Thanet, Tonbridge and Malling, Folkestone and Hythe, and Gravesham) are the local planning authorities that decide most planning applications, including householder applications such as solar panels. Medway sits outside Kent County Council's area as a separate unitary authority.

FAQs

Common questions about solar in Kent

What could a roof in Kent generate?

PVGIS puts a roof in Kent at 1,075 kWh per kWp a year, 2.94 peak sun hours a day averaged across the seasons.

What does a typical solar system cost in Kent?

A typical 12 panel, 6.36 kWp system in Kent costs around £6,360 installed, at £1,000 per kWp before any battery.

Would a system in Kent need approval from the network operator?

Kent's network operator (DNO) is UK Power Networks. Most home systems only need the simpler G98 notification, made after installation; larger systems need the fuller G99 process instead, applied for directly with UK Power Networks (their G99 page).
